The Gyakuten Kenji Original Soundtrack is a two-disc soundtrack album featuring background music from the video game Gyakuten Kenji (known internationally as Ace Attorney Investigations: Miles Edgeworth). Music is composed by Noriyuki Iwadare and Yasuko Yamada.
